An event last 5 hours and 30 minutes. How long did the event las in seconds?

Here: First, you multiply the hours into minutes, so 60 minute is 1 hour, so 5 x 60 (Or 60 x 5) = 300, then since those are minutes, add the 30 minutes you have, 300 + 30 = 330, then multiply the minutes into seconds, which would be 330 x 60 (Or 60 x 330) = 19800 since there are 60 seconds in a minute, so your answer would be 19800 seconds.
